Output 78c62f579cd2afbee269f139a7a13d6682d0afc72d8ac3777e35e81f9905d50a:0

value
17000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cf645ae9e3ceb485d4183b079d964020eb9f38b3 OP_EQUALVERIFY OP_CHECKSIG
address
1Kub6WL4YoWrtEDR1HBnTN265P1imh99rA
transaction
78c62f579cd2afbee269f139a7a13d6682d0afc72d8ac3777e35e81f9905d50a
spent
true